Praying for loved one's Salvation:(Brother Owen)


1. Four mistakes in praying for salvation:
(1) "Asking" God to save them!!
Instead, in Jesus name, break the power of Satan, blinding
the mind of your loved one.
Image Hosted by ImageShack.us2 Corinthians 4:4 The god of this age has blinded the minds of unbelievers, so that they cannot see the light of the gospel of the glory of Christ, who is the image of God. Then instead of "asking" God to save them, speak it into
existence--"Loose or decree salvation:".
Image Hosted by ImageShack.usMark 11: 23"I tell you the truth, if anyone says to this mountain, 'Go, throw yourself into the sea,' and does not doubt in his heart but believes that what he says will happen, it will be done for him."
Image Hosted by ImageShack.us
Matthew. 21:21 Jesus replied, "I tell you the truth, if you have faith and do not doubt, not only can you do what was done to the fig tree, but also you can say to this mountain, 'Go, throw yourself into the sea,' and it will be done.

Image Hosted by ImageShack.usJob 22:28 What you decide on will be done, and light will shine on your ways. 
and
Image Hosted by ImageShack.usMatthew 16:19, "I will give you the keys of the kingdom of heaven; whatever you bind on earth will be bound in heaven, and whatever you loose on earth will be loosed in heaven."
(2) Not "praying through.
" Pray, do spiritual warfare, until
you "know that you know" you have the answer. There are two types of faith.
One is heart faith and the other is mental or intellectual
faith. You will have "heart faith" when you "pray through" by much prayer, praise, worship, and often tears of travail. Sometimes you will
need to fast for the breakthrough.
It may take seconds, minutes, hours, or even days to pray
through. Some fasting might be necessary. You will have a "knowing" or a deep, peaceful feeling that you have the answer, that you have "prayed through."
(3) Through a lack of "patience."
You must hold on in faith until you see the salvation take place. Keep praising God for the answer.
Image Hosted by ImageShack.usHebrews 10:36 "For ye have need of patience that after ye have done the will of God, ye might receive the promise".
See also
Image Hosted by ImageShack.usHebrews 10:23 Let us hold fast the profession of our faith without wavering;(for he is faithful that promised;)
 You can lose the miracle by becoming negative about your
loved one, instead of "holding fast to the profession of your faith."
This is a faith principle.
(4) Not DEEPLY forgiving them.
You must forgive your loved ones, release them to the Lord, and treat them with love. DON'T PREACH
TO THEM. Let God save them!
 Image Hosted by ImageShack.usMark 11:25, "And when you stand praying, if you hold anything against anyone, forgive him, so that your Father in heaven may forgive you your sins.""
1. Examples
(1) Norvell Hayes' daughter. God spoke to Norvell Hayes to stop preaching to his daughter, and just love her. Also he was told he must spend much time, even days, in prayer, until he had the assurance of her salvation. He did this and soon his daughter was beautifully
saved.
(2) Prostitute saved. Yonngi Cho advised the mother to "see" her daughter as saved and treat her as though she were already saved,
and holy. Her love and respect won her daughter quickly, and now she is an outstanding evangelist for the Lord. Faith works by love.
(3) Pastor's son saved through fasting. Rev. and Mrs. Heflin both fasted for long periods of time for their twenty-nine year old
son's salvation, the late Wallace Heflin, Jr. Having run from God for years, he was saved and became an outstanding evangelist, ministering
in 80 nations for the Lord.
(4) A husband and wife fasted and prayed much each day for three weeks for revival in their small church. An angel appeared to a hard-hearted sinner, and he and his large family, and many friends were
saved practically filling the church.
(5) A Buddhist saved. He wanted no part of Christianity. His nephew in Jesus Name, "broke the power of Satan" blinding him to the truth, "decreed" his salvation, and soon he was saved.
You can do the same and see your loved ones saved, and transformed by the Lord.
